Abstract

In recent years, a method of plyometrics (exercises that cause a rapid lengthening of a muscle prior to contraction) called depth jumping has become a part of the training routine of many athletes. Two experiments are described in which the effectiveness of the exercises is examined. In Experiment 1, undergraduate students in beginning weight training classes trained with three different jumping programs: (1) maximum vertical jumps, (2) 0.3 m depth jumps, and (3) 0.75 m and 1.10 m depth jumps. In addition, all groups also lifted weights. In Experiment 2, a weight training class and the volleyball team at Brigham Young University-Hawaii were divided into two groups. One group lifted weights and performed 0.75 and 1.10 m depth jumps. The other group only lifted weights. In Experiment 1, the three training programs resulted in increases in one repetition maximum (1 RM) squat strength, isometric knee extension strength, and in vertical jump; however, there were no significant differences between treatments. In Experiment 2, all groups made significant increases in vertical jump, except the group of weight lifters, who did no jumping. It was concluded that depth jumps are effective but not more effective than a regular jumping routine.  相似文献

Abstract

Because of increasing numbers of serious sports-related injuries at all levels of participation, the National Operating Committee on Standards for Athletic Equipment (NOCSAE) was formed. Among their activities aimed at improving the safety of sports participation was the development of standards for impact resistance in both new and refinished football helmets. These standards include not only recommendations as to safe levels of resistance to impact but recommendations as to the number of helmets to be tested from each group of helmets undergoing a refinishing process.

In this study the various sources of variability in the testing procedure are examined. These sources include helmet-to-helmet variability, testing variability, and basic measurement error. A careful examination of this variability in the context of the NOCSAE-recommended testing procedures for recertifying helmets reveals an inadequacy in the NOCSAE standard, in that the probability of returning unsafe helmets to the playing field is unacceptably high.  相似文献

Diffusion of autocrine and paracrine signaling molecules allows cells to communicate in the absence of physical contact. This chemical-based, long-range communication serves crucial roles in tissue function, activation of the immune system, and other physiological functions. Despite its importance, few in vitro methods to study cell-cell signaling through paracrine factors are available today. Here, we report the design and validation of a microfluidic platform that enables (i) soluble molecule-cell and/or (ii) cell-cell paracrine signaling. In the microfluidic platform, multiple cell populations can be introduced into parallel channels. The channels are separated by arrays of posts allowing diffusion of paracrine molecules between cell populations. A computational analysis was performed to aid design of the microfluidic platform. Specifically, it revealed that channel spacing affects both spatial and temporal distribution of signaling molecules, while the initial concentration of the signaling molecule mainly affects the concentration of the signaling molecules excreted by the cells. To validate the microfluidic platform, a model system composed of the signaling molecule lipopolysaccharide, mouse macrophages, and engineered human embryonic kidney cells was introduced into the platform. Upon diffusion from the first channel to the second channel, lipopolysaccharide activates the macrophages which begin to produce TNF-α. The TNF-α diffuses from the second channel to the third channel to stimulate the kidney cells, which express green fluorescent protein (GFP) in response. By increasing the initial lipopolysaccharide concentration an increase in fluorescent response was recorded, demonstrating the ability to quantify intercellular communication between 3D cellular constructs using the microfluidic platform reported here. Overall, these studies provide a detailed analysis on how concentration of the initial signaling molecules, spatiotemporal dynamics, and inter-channel spacing affect intercellular communication.  相似文献

ABSTRACT

The National Institutes of Health (NIH) funds biomedical research and conducts its own research. One way the NIH Library supports this work is by providing librarians with biomedical training and encouraging them to become embedded with researchers and administrators. Some of these “informationists” have degrees in scientific or health fields, and all engage in ongoing training, mostly through coursework at local institutions and at NIH itself. This article elaborates on the training of NIH informationists. Past research has indicated that patrons welcome librarians with biomedical training, which may in turn lead to greater communication between librarians and researchers.  相似文献

One of the distinctive features of the English encounter with mass higher education has been the uncertain and ambiguous role of further education colleges as providers of undergraduate education. Both before and during the major expansion that marked the shift to a mass scale of higher education in England, the higher education offered by colleges in the further education sector was commonly regarded as a residual or ancillary activity; its courses mostly at levels below the first degree and its growth in numbers among the slowest in higher education. In the period that followed, these same colleges were accorded a special mission in the delivery of short‐cycle undergraduate education and, through their involvement in foundation degrees, were expected to lead a large part of the expansion in future years. The elevation of this provision, from a zone of ‘low’ or no policy to one of ‘high’ policy, has coincided with a radical reform of the planning, funding and quality arrangements for post‐compulsory education. Under conditions less than favourable to the achievement of their higher education goals, colleges remain the responsibility of one administrative sector and higher education institutions the responsibility of another.  相似文献
